ISRO SAC Recruitment 2026 Notice Out for 48 JRF, Research Associate and Project Scientist Vacancies With Pay Ranging from ₹37,000 to ₹67,000
- ISRO SAC Ahmedabad has announced 48 JRF, Research Associate and Project Scientist-I vacancies.
- Posts cover engineering, remote sensing, computer science, geophysics and related disciplines.
- Online applications are open until September 30, 2026, with pay ranging from ₹37,000 to ₹67,000 plus HRA.

The Space Applications Centre (SAC), Ahmedabad, under the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) and Department of Space, has opened recruitment for 48 temporary project positions under Advertisement No. SAC:02:2026. The recruitment includes Junior Research Fellow (JRF), Research Associate (RA) and Project Scientist-I posts across 16 technical and scientific specialisations.
Online registration began at 10 AM on September 10, 2026 and will close at 5 PM on September 30. Candidates with the prescribed B.E./B.Tech, M.E./M.Tech, M.Sc or Ph.D qualifications can apply according to the relevant post code. JRF applicants additionally need a valid NET, GATE or equivalent national-level test as prescribed. No application fee is charged.

ISRO SAC Vacancy Details 2026
The 48 positions are distributed across seven JRF post codes, three Research Associate post codes and six Project Scientist-I post codes.
| Post Code | Post | Field / Discipline | Vacancies |
|---|---|---|---|
| 01 | JRF | Semiconductor / Quantum / Micro-Nano Devices / RF & Microwave | 3 |
| 02 | JRF | ECE / VLSI / Digital Systems / Embedded Systems / Signal Processing | 7 |
| 03 | JRF | Engineering Physics / Photonics / Optoelectronics / Material Science | 5 |
| 04 | JRF | Atmospheric Sciences / Meteorology / Oceanography / Physics / Mathematics | 10 |
| 05 | JRF | Geophysics / Earth Sciences / Geotechnical Engineering | 2 |
| 06 | JRF | Computer Science / Computer Engineering | 4 |
| 07 | JRF | Geo-informatics / Remote Sensing & GIS | 2 |
| 08 | Research Associate | Oceanic / Marine / Atmospheric / Earth System Sciences / Physics | 6 |
| 09 | Research Associate | Mathematics / Physics | 1 |
| 10 | Research Associate | Earth / Environmental Sciences – Remote Sensing in Forestry / Ecology / Wetlands | 1 |
| 11 | Project Scientist-I | Geophysics – Cryosphere Studies | 1 |
| 12 | Project Scientist-I | Ecology / Environmental Sciences / Forestry / Geo-informatics | 1 |
| 13 | Project Scientist-I | Remote Sensing & GIS / Geo-informatics / Civil Engineering | 1 |
| 14 | Project Scientist-I | Geophysics / Earth Sciences – Crustal Deformation | 1 |
| 15 | Project Scientist-I | Water Resources / Hydrology / Soil and Water Engineering | 2 |
| 16 | Project Scientist-I | RF & Microwave / Applied Physics | 1 |
| Total | — | — | 48 |
Only Indian nationals are eligible to apply. These project positions do not confer any right to regular appointment in ISRO or the Department of Space.
Qualification Requirements
Junior Research Fellow
For JRF post codes 01 to 07, candidates need the prescribed B.E./B.Tech, M.E./M.Tech or M.Sc qualification in the relevant discipline.
Applicants must also possess a valid NET, GATE or equivalent national-level test qualification as on September 30, 2026.
Research Associate
For Research Associate post codes 08 to 10, candidates generally require a Ph.D in the relevant discipline.
For Post Code 08, the prescribed alternative route includes three years of research, teaching, design or development experience after M.E./M.Tech, along with at least one research paper published in an SCI journal.
Project Scientist-I
For Project Scientist-I post codes 11 to 16, the required qualification is Ph.D and/or M.E./M.Tech in the relevant specialisation, depending on the individual post code.
Minimum Marks Requirement
| Qualification | Minimum Requirement |
|---|---|
| M.E. / M.Tech | 60% marks or CGPA 6.5/10 |
| M.Sc / B.E. / B.Tech | 65% marks or CGPA 6.84/10 |
Rounding off of marks and conversion between CGPA and percentage are not permitted for meeting the prescribed eligibility threshold.
Candidates pursuing professional courses through Open and Distance Learning mode are not eligible. Applicants whose final result has not been declared by September 30, 2026 are also not eligible.
Age Limit
Age will be calculated as on September 30, 2026.
| Post | Maximum Age |
|---|---|
| Junior Research Fellow | 28 years |
| Research Associate | 35 years |
| Project Scientist-I | 35 years |
Age relaxation is five years for SC/ST candidates and three years for OBC-NCL candidates. Other Government of India relaxations apply where applicable.
Fellowship and Salary
The remuneration depends on the post and, for Research Associates, the applicable RA level.
| Post / Level | Monthly Fellowship / Remuneration |
|---|---|
| JRF – 1st and 2nd Year | ₹37,000 + HRA |
| JRF – Subsequent Years | ₹42,000 + HRA |
| Project Scientist-I | ₹56,000 + HRA |
| Research Associate – Level 1 | ₹58,000 + HRA |
| Research Associate – Level 2 | ₹61,000 + HRA |
| Research Associate – Level 3 | ₹67,000 + HRA |
HRA will be payable where hostel accommodation is not provided. The engagement also provides medical facility for the selected candidate only, subject to the applicable terms.
Project staff will not receive the concessions available to regular ISRO employees.
Tenure of Appointment
The duration differs by category and remains subject to project requirements.
| Post | Initial Tenure | Maximum / Further Tenure |
|---|---|---|
| JRF | 1 year | Up to 5 years |
| Research Associate | 1 year | Up to 3 years |
| Project Scientist-I | 1 year | Up to project duration; co-terminus with project |
Continuation beyond the initial period will be governed by project requirements and the applicable engagement conditions.
ISRO SAC Selection Process
Selection will be based on interview.
Where the number of applicants is high, SAC may first shortlist candidates on the basis of academic performance, specialisation and other relevant criteria.
The process will therefore involve:
- Shortlisting, if required
- Interview
The shortlist and interview schedule will be published on the SAC website. Interview call letters will be sent by email only to shortlisted candidates.
The final panel will be prepared on the basis of interview performance.
